Transaction 908bc38328036be23bebcd59cfb601e9fad5411b33b68deb81996efd2f7741d1
1 Input
1 Output
-
908bc38328036be23bebcd59cfb601e9fad5411b33b68deb81996efd2f7741d1:0
- value
- 12523121
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9095fc07796aba8bd2cd4585668adfa306ed58e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EBVyjFvV546bsfrjerx8MSpJWgYzn9qSU